Double premiere: Matip named Premier League Player of the Month for the first time

Joel Matip was named Premier League Player of the Month for the first time – because he not only impressed defensively.

Liverpool FC had strung together twelve competitive wins by Tuesday’s ultimately insignificant 1-0 defeat to Inter Milan, seven of them in a packed February alone. Now Joel Matip has been handed another belated success.

The Premier League named the Reds centre-back as their Player of the Month. A double first: for the first time since his transfer on a free transfer from FC Schalke 04 to Liverpool almost six years ago, Matip won the award – and for the first time a Cameroonian.

In Liverpool’s four February league games, which served as the basis for the assessment, the Bochum native had not missed a minute and helped ensure that his team conceded only one goal. He also set up Diogo Jota’s 2-0 final goal against Leicester and scored himself in the 6-0 win over Leeds.

That was enough for the 30-year-old to leave behind Ché Adams (Southampton), Ryan Fraser (Newcastle), Harry Kane (Tottenham), Ben Mee (Burnley) and Wilfried Zaha (Crystal Palace), who were also nominated. After Mohamed Salah in October and Trent Alexander-Arnold in November, Matip is already the third decorated Liverpool player this season.
